What Contaminants Are Commonly Found in Fish from Comanche Trail Lake?
Contaminants commonly found in fish from Comanche Trail Lake include mercury, polychlorinated biphenyls (PCBs), and other heavy metals. These contaminants can affect fish health and pose risks to human consumers.
- Mercury
- Polychlorinated biphenyls (PCBs)
- Other heavy metals (e.g., lead, cadmium)
- Microplastics
The presence of these contaminants raises public health concerns and influences fishing regulations.
-
Mercury: Mercury is a toxic heavy metal that accumulates in the bodies of fish over time. This accumulation occurs primarily through the food chain, as smaller fish consume mercury-laden organisms. According to the U.S. Environmental Protection Agency (EPA), high levels of mercury can affect brain development, especially in fetuses and young children. A study from the National Oceanic and Atmospheric Administration (NOAA) reported that some fish from Comanche Trail Lake exhibit elevated mercury levels, raising health advisories for consumption, particularly for vulnerable populations.
-
Polychlorinated Biphenyls (PCBs): PCBs are synthetic organic chemicals that were widely used in electrical equipment and other industrial applications until they were banned due to their toxicity. In fish, PCBs are known to cause harmful effects on the immune, reproductive, and nervous systems. Research published by the Texas Commission on Environmental Quality shows that fish in Comanche Trail Lake have shown higher levels of PCBs, which may originate from industrial runoff previously discharged into the water.
-
Other Heavy Metals: Fish in Comanche Trail Lake can also accumulate heavy metals such as lead and cadmium. These metals enter the lake through runoff and atmospheric deposition. Lead exposure is particularly concerning, as it can affect neurological health and development in children, while cadmium is known to cause kidney damage with long-term exposure. Data from the Texas Parks and Wildlife Department (TPWD) indicates that some species caught in this lake have tested positive for elevated levels of these metals.
-
Microplastics: Microplastics are small plastic particles that degrade from larger plastic debris. They enter water bodies through residential runoff, wastewater, and marine activities. Fish can ingest these microplastics, and recent studies suggest that they may carry chemicals that can affect human health when consumed. Research from a 2022 publication in Environmental Science & Technology highlights concerns about the potential health impact of consuming fish containing microplastics, emphasizing the need for better monitoring of marine ecosystems.

How Can You Reduce Health Risks When Eating Fish from Comanche Trail Lake?
To reduce health risks when eating fish from Comanche Trail Lake, you should follow guidelines on species selection, portion control, and preparation methods.
First, select fish species with lower mercury levels. Certain species accumulate higher levels of mercury, which can be harmful to health. According to the Environmental Protection Agency (EPA), fish like bass and catfish generally have higher mercury levels, while species such as trout and panfish are considered safer options.
Second, control portion sizes. The Texas Department of State Health Services recommends limiting fish consumption to avoid excessive exposure to contaminants. For example, they suggest eating no more than one serving per week of larger fish species. A serving is typically about 8 ounces for adults and 4 ounces for children.
Third, prepare fish properly. Cooking methods can impact health risks. For instance, grilling, baking, or broiling fish allows fats and contaminants to drain away. Additionally, avoiding frying can help reduce the intake of unhealthy fats and potential carcinogens formed during the frying process.
Finally, stay informed about local advisories. Regularly check for consumption advisories issued by local health departments or agencies regarding fish caught in Comanche Trail Lake. These advisories may provide updates on any contaminant levels and safe consumption guidelines based on recent testing or findings.
